You would have seen some websites/web pages with www while some without it. For most of the readers, it doesn't make any difference, actually they may not even notice it most of the times. But for search engines, it matters a lot. Search engines like Google, consider them as separate web pages or web sites. That means, when someone links to your website, as he may/may not use the www prefix to the link, so according to that the PR juice will be distributed between the www and non-www versions of your same original blog/website, moreover as search engines consider them as separate web pages, so your blog may get penalized for duplicate content issues :) that's true...
So to avoid these issues, go to Google and tell it's bot to consider both the www and non-www versions are same for your blog:
Follow these steps:
1. If you already have your account in "Google Webmaster Tools", and have submitted your blog's sitemap, then proceed or else read and add the sitemap to Google first.
2. Now once your account is active, then go to Settings Page, and in the "Preferred Domain" section, select any one radio button, as you like [either www or non-www]
